What is Hair Mousse?
Mousse is a styling foam. It usually comes in a pressurized aerosol can. It can be applied to hair to provide hold and body. Mousse feels lighter than gel, and doesn’t hold as long. But it is easier to reapply as needed. Mousse is great for most hair lengths and won’t weigh down your hair. It also helps tame frizz while increasing volume.
What is Hair Gel?
Styling gel is a jelly-like substance that often comes in a squeeze tube or jar. Gel may be clear or colored. It is a thick substance that can be spread across your hair. Gel is strong enough to hold hair up for spikes or mohawk styles. It is also helpful for taming flyaways and cowlicks. Gel is effective at fighting static and humidity. Too much gel can leave hair feeling too rigid.
When to Use Gel Or Mousse
Gel is best used for adding dimension and taming flyaways. IT holds up longer and can handle humidity better. But it may be too heavy for finer hair types. Mousse is better at adding volume and bounce while holding hair in place. Mousse works well with finer hair. It is also better at holding waves or curls in normally straight hair.
